    What was Christmas like in America’s Southwest Frontier? It’s 1824… the warm dusty streets are filled with all the sights, sounds and smells of Christmas!  Biscochos, piñon smoke, farolitos, las posadas, and mariachi! Maybe this sounds like Christmas in another country to you! Nope!  These are all some of the things Josefina Montoya loved about Christmas in her beloved Santa Fe! While Christmas in the early 1800’s wasn’t being celebrated in a big way in most places in America just yet, Christmas was a very special and important part of the culture of New Mexico!
